To solve the problem, we start with the given equation:

4x+2=124x + 2 = 12

First, we solve for xx:

  1. Subtract 2 from both sides: 4x+22=1224x + 2 - 2 = 12 - 2 4x=104x = 10

  2. Divide both sides by 4: x=104x = \frac{10}{4} x=2.5x = 2.5

Next, we need to find the value of 16x+816x + 8:

16x+8=16(2.5)+816x + 8 = 16(2.5) + 8

Calculate 16×2.516 \times 2.5:

16×2.5=4016 \times 2.5 = 40

Then add 8:

40+8=4840 + 8 = 48

So, the value of 16x+816x + 8 is:

48\boxed{48}
